As a policy, reporters will not utilize a long word when a brief one will certainly do. They utilize subject-verb-object building and construction and dazzling, energetic prose (see Grammar). They offer narratives, instances and allegories, and they seldom depend on generalizations or abstract ideas. News writers try to stay clear of making use of the very same word greater than as soon as in a paragraph (in some cases called an "echo" or "word mirror").


Headings occasionally leave out the topic (e.g., "Jumps From Boat, Catches in Wheel") or verb (e.g., "Cat female fortunate"). A subhead (likewise subhed, sub-headline, subheading, subtitle, deck or dek) can be either a secondary title under the main heading, or the heading of a subsection of the post. It is a heading that precedes the major message, or a group of paragraphs of the main text.

Long or complicated write-ups commonly have more than one subheading. Subheads are thus one sort of entrance factor that help viewers choose, such as where to start (or quit) analysis. A post signboard is capsule summary text, frequently simply one sentence or fragment, which is put into a sidebar or message box (reminiscent of an outdoor billboard) on the exact same page to get the reader's attention as they are flipping through the pages to motivate them to quit and read that post.


Added billboards of any of these kinds may appear later on in the short article (specifically on subsequent web pages) to entice more reading. Such signboards are additionally utilized as reminders to the short article in various other sections of the magazine or site, or as ads for the piece in various other magazine or sites. While a guideline states the lead must respond to most or every one of the 5 Ws, couple of leads can fit every one of these - News Articles. Write-up leads are occasionally categorized right into tough leads and soft leads. A tough lead aims to supply a detailed thesis which informs the visitor what the article will cover.


Example of a hard-lead paragraph NASA is proposing another room job. The company's budget plan request, introduced today, consisted of a strategy to send out one more mission to the Moon. This time around the firm really hopes to establish a long-term facility as a jumping-off point for various other area adventures. The budget plan demands approximately $10 billion for the task.


An "off-lead" is the 2nd most essential front web page information of the day. To "bury the lead" click site is to begin the post with history info or details of additional importance to the visitors, requiring them to read more deeply right into a post than they ought to have to in order to uncover the important factors.

Common use is that a person or two sentences each develop their own paragraph. Reporters usually describe the organization or structure of a news tale as an upside down pyramid. The crucial and most interesting aspects of a tale are placed at the beginning, with supporting info adhering to in order of diminishing importance.


It allows people to check out a topic to only the depth that their inquisitiveness takes them, and without the imposition of details or nuances that they can think about pointless, however still making that info offered to a lot more interested viewers. The upside down pyramid structure also allows short articles to be cut to any arbitrary length during format, to suit the area readily available.

Longer posts, such as magazine cover write-ups and the pieces that lead the within sections of a paper, are referred to as. Attribute tales differ from straight news in numerous means. Foremost is the lack of a straight-news lead, most of the moment. Instead of offering the significance of a story in advance, feature writers might attempt to draw viewers in.

The reporter often details communications with interview topics, making the item extra individual. A function's first paragraphs frequently associate an appealing moment or event, as in an "anecdotal lead". From look at this website the particulars of a person or episode, its view rapidly expands to generalizations concerning the story's subject. The section that signals what a feature is about is called the or billboard.
